Job Title: Senior / Principal EICA Engineer – Water Sector
Location: Aberdeen (Hybrid – 2-3 days office-based per week)
Sector: Water
Type: Permanent, Full-Time
Overview
An expanding engineering consultancy is seeking a highly motivated Senior or Principal Electrical, Instrumentation, Control & Automation (EICA) Engineer to support a growing portfolio of water and wastewater projects across the UK. This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ced engineer to lead multidisciplinary design work and contribute to major UK water utility projects. The role encompasses feasibility studies, front-end engineering design (FEED), detailed design, and construction support.
